Humans, unlike other animals that are drawn to water, are not natural-born swimmers. We must be taught. Our evolutionary ancestors learned for survival; now in the 21st century, we swim in freezing Arctic waters and piranha-infested rivers to test our limits. Swimming is an introspective and silent sport in a chaotic and noisy age; it’s therapeutic for both the mind and body; and it's an adventurous way to get from point A to point B. It's also one route to that elusive, ecstatic state of flow.

A More Layered Super Hero Sory
Revisado: 08-22-20
Kudos to Gus Krieger for creating his own, unique superhero story. Yes, it has all the exciting elements that draws fans to superheroes in the first place, but Superworld digs deeper with a protagonist who is a normal human being struggling with feelings of inadequacy and desires to be special, important and "super" in the world around him. Krieger challenges us to ponder what it actually means to be a hero. Is it someone with a supernatural talent? Is it someone who volunteers for work in a soup kitchen? Is it someone who kills a despot who would have killed hundreds? Is it someone who simply takes the time to listen to a child? Most of all, if someone has a super talent or super ability, would he/she use it for good/altruistic purposes or evil/selfish purposes? Krieger has a super talent with words, and he definitely uses his unique ability for good purposes in Superworld. I look forward to reading more from him.
The narrators are fantastic as well, particularly Berman with his great commitment to the depth of the characters created by Krieger.
